Why Live in Countryside

In the summer, youth baseball teams load the bases at Countryside Park. The ice rink is typically flooded and frozen in mid-December, and parents push their kids on the playground swingset. The surrounding West Edina neighborhood, which shares its name—Countryside—with this 9-acre park, has remained more or less the same for the past 50 years. And folks tend to stick around Countryside, even after their kids are grown and gone. Here, gently sloped streets are lined with mid-century homes, the occasional small church and oak trees that shed their colorful leaves come fall. John McWhite, a Coldwell Banker agent with more than a decade of experience, says it’s the large lot sizes that set this neighborhood apart. “There’s more room here than in other parts of town, and homebuyers like that it feels a little rural,” he says. Adding “A lot of people who move here are excited about the bigger yards. It’s just nice to have more space to breathe.” Highways 62 (aka Crosstown Highway) and 100 are less than a mile away, meaning “It’s easy to get from point A to point B, so you don’t have to sacrifice being close to everything in favor of that space” says McWhite. Frequently Asked Questions

Is Countryside a good place to live?
Countryside is a good place to live. Countryside is considered very car-dependent and bikeable with minimal transit options. Countryside is a neighborhood with a crime score of 1, making it safer than the average neighborhood in the U.S. Countryside has 6 parks for recreational activities. It is fairly sparse in population with 4.9 people per acre and a median age of 49. The average household income is $203,650 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 79.3% of residents. A majority of residents in Countryside are home owners, with 9.5% of residents renting and 90.5% of residents owning their home.
